12 Railway track ballast Geological Society London

Railway track formations generally consist essentially of a layer of coarse aggregate or ballast in which the sleepers are embedded see Fig The ballast may rest directly on the subgrade or depending on the bearing capacity on a layer of blanketing sand The layer of ballast is intended to provide a free draining base which is

Evaluation of the Strength of Railway Ballast Using Point

The ballast layer is one of the most important components of the railway track superstructure in which angular aggregates of high strength rocks are used Ballast degradation is one of the main sources of railway problems in which the ballast aggregates are gradually degraded due to the abrasion of the sharp corners of the angular particles and splitting each

Study of Ballast Fouling in Railway Track Formations

Indian railway ballast standards do not address the requirements of bulk density and particle density for the rail ballast The Australian standard [] specifies that the bulk density of ballast material shall not be less than 1 200 kg/m 3 and that the particle density on a dry basis of ballast material shall not be less than 2 500 kg/m order to ensure the stability of the track
